There is a stone quarry within the boundary of Coyote Hills Regional Park.
There is a road from Paseo Padre Parkway that will take you to the quarry. I
think the quarry is being abandoned and the area will eventually become part of the park.
You can see part of the quarry, i.e., a giant
hole in the rock, from the Apay Way trail and overpass (above Hwy. 84)
that connects Don Edwards Fish and Wildlife Refuge
and Coyote Hills. The shape of the accummulated water in the quarry is in the
shape of South America. It will be interesting to see how this land is brought back
